How accurate are these MyFitnessPal: Calorie Counter vs Owlet Dream revenue estimates? v
Directional - typically within 2-3× of actual money earned for popular apps. The $3.02M for MyFitnessPal: Calorie Counter and $47.3K for Owlet Dream are derived from Google Play grossing rank, scraped IAP tiers, ratings volume and category benchmarks (Health & Fitness) - net of the 15-30% Apple/Google store cut. Real revenue depends on country mix, retention, refunds and ad fill rate, none of which Apple or Google publish.
